Krystyna Skarbek. Called Winston Churchill's favorite spy. A legend among spies. The first woman spy in the history of British intelligence. She became an inspiration for Ian Fleming author of James Bond novels. Her remarkable biography is now directed by James Marquand. “Skarbek” is a gripping spy thriller.
